引言
随着移动互联网的快速发展,移动端编程已经成为软件开发领域的重要方向。本文将深入探讨当前移动端编程的趋势,分析最新的技术动态,并指导开发者如何掌握这些技术,以引领行业发展。
一、移动端编程技术概述
1.1 移动操作系统
目前,移动端主要操作系统包括Android和iOS。Android由谷歌开发,基于Linux内核,拥有庞大的用户群体;iOS由苹果公司开发,以其封闭的生态系统和高性能著称。
1.2 移动端编程语言
- Java/Kotlin:Android开发的主要语言,Java历史悠久,Kotlin作为其现代替代品,具有简洁、安全的特点。
- Swift:iOS开发的主要语言,由苹果公司开发,具有高性能、易用性等优点。
二、移动端编程趋势分析
2.1 跨平台开发
随着跨平台开发框架(如Flutter、React Native)的兴起,开发者可以编写一次代码,同时在多个平台上运行。这种趋势降低了开发成本,提高了开发效率。
2.2 人工智能与移动端结合
人工智能技术在移动端的应用越来越广泛,如语音识别、图像识别、自然语言处理等。开发者需要掌握相关技术,以提升移动应用的用户体验。
2.3 云计算与移动端融合
云计算为移动端应用提供了强大的后端支持,使得移动应用可以更加高效、稳定地运行。开发者需要关注云计算技术在移动端的应用,以提升应用性能。
2.4 5G技术推动移动端发展
5G技术的普及将为移动端应用带来更高的网络速度、更低的延迟,这将推动移动端应用向更高性能、更智能化的方向发展。
三、掌握最新技术,引领行业发展
3.1 学习跨平台开发技术
开发者应学习Flutter、React Native等跨平台开发框架,提高开发效率,降低成本。
3.2 关注人工智能与移动端结合
学习人工智能相关技术,如机器学习、深度学习等,将人工智能应用于移动端应用,提升用户体验。
3.3 掌握云计算技术
了解云计算平台(如阿里云、腾讯云)的相关知识,将云计算应用于移动端应用,提高应用性能。
3.4 关注5G技术发展
了解5G技术特点,关注其在移动端应用中的发展,为未来移动端应用做好准备。
四、总结
移动端编程技术日新月异,开发者需要紧跟技术发展趋势,不断学习新知识,掌握新技术。通过本文的介绍,相信开发者能够更好地了解移动端编程趋势,为行业发展贡献力量。
